Done it (unfortunately) more than once on my 'bird.
After the first time, it became apparent that the factory puts the
dash in as a mostly assembled unit. Specifically, disconnect the main
wiring harness at the bulkhead connector.
Lots easier than trying to remove all the individual components one
at a time. And another set of hands will really help.
